codecamp

Subversion集成SVN项目或目录

集成SVN项目或目录

在Subversion中集成项目或目录意味着将两个指定修订之间的差异合并到工作副本中。

该"集成项目(Integrate Project)"命令可用于Subversion和Perforce。

集成结果显示在版本控制工具窗口的“更新信息(Update Info)”选项卡中。文件的上下文菜单允许您比较版本、查看文件历史记录和注释、浏览更改等。

Subversion集成

要将不同的源集成到一个Subversion项目中,请执行以下操作:

  1. 从主菜单中选择:VCS | 集成项目(VCS | Integrate Project)。“集成项目(Integrate Project)”对话框打开。
  2. 如果Subversion和Perforce都用作项目中的版本控制系统,请选择“Subversion”选项卡。
  3. 在“源1(Source 1)”和“ 源2(Source 2)”字段中,指定要合并的源,并选择修订版本。如果选中“指定(Specified)”选项,则可以单击“浏览(Browse)”按钮 并从“更改浏览器(Changes Browser)”中选择一个修订。
  4. 如有必要,请选择以下合并选项,然后单击“确定”:
    • 使用祖先:如果选择这个选项,文件的祖先将被注意到(这对应于 svn merge命令)。如果未选中,则文件和目录之间的任何关系都将被忽略(对应于svn diff)。
    • 请尝试合并但不作任何更改:选择此选项可通过启用SVN命令的--dry--run选项来预览合并结果 。如果未选中,则会默认合并源代码。
    • Depth(深度):使用此下拉列表来将递归范围指定为 Subversion 子目录。可用的选项是:
      • 工作副本(working copy):选择此选项可从尚未检出的存储库子树中获取文件/目录。
      • 空(empty):选择此选项只涉及当前文件。
      • 文件(files):选择此选项涉及当前文件夹中的文件。
      • 立即(immediates):选择此选项涉及当前文件的直接子项。
      • 无穷大(infinity):选择此选项以启用完整递归。
如何通过Subversion将更改集成到分支
Subversion将更改集成到功能分支
温馨提示
下载编程狮App,免费阅读超1000+编程语言教程
取消
确定
目录

IntelliJ IDEA的一般准则

什么是IntelliJ IDEA项目

使用IntelliJ IDEA的意图行为

IntelliJ IDEA使用运行/调试配置

特定于VCS的程序

IntelliJ IDEA语言和特定框架指南

IntelliJ IDEA的数据库和SQL功能

IntelliJ IDEA使用之JavaServer Faces(JSF)

IntelliJ IDEA:分析PHP应用程序的性能

IntelliJ IDEA:调试PHP应用程序

IntelliJ IDEA:适用于PHP的Google App Engine

IntelliJ IDEA更多内容

关闭

MIP.setData({ 'pageTheme' : getCookie('pageTheme') || {'day':true, 'night':false}, 'pageFontSize' : getCookie('pageFontSize') || 20 }); MIP.watch('pageTheme', function(newValue){ setCookie('pageTheme', JSON.stringify(newValue)) }); MIP.watch('pageFontSize', function(newValue){ setCookie('pageFontSize', newValue) }); function setCookie(name, value){ var days = 1; var exp = new Date(); exp.setTime(exp.getTime() + days*24*60*60*1000); document.cookie = name + '=' + value + ';expires=' + exp.toUTCString(); } function getCookie(name){ var reg = new RegExp('(^| )' + name + '=([^;]*)(;|$)'); return document.cookie.match(reg) ? JSON.parse(document.cookie.match(reg)[2]) : null; }